About the Role:

As a Sr. Engineering Manager - Salesforce Growth IT within our Go-to-market Applications team, you will be a driver of CrowdStrike's growth over the next year and beyond. Our team consists of Salesforce BSA, developers, and QA resources. This allows us to design, build, and ship features to support sales and channel in pitching new products, expanding to new markets, expanding partnerships with our customer and using new sales tactics to foster growth. We are looking for an engineering leader to help us build the next level of Salesforce and eCommerce experience.

What You'll Do:

Team Management and Salesforce delivery:
  • Lead and mentor a distributed team of developers and QA, fostering growth across various experience levels and technologies within the Salesforce and partner commerce ecosystem.
  • Collaborate with business stakeholders and cross-functional IT peers (business analysts, integrations, PMO) to deliver high-impact sales and partner experiences.
  • Act as a strategic consultant by partnering with business stakeholders to maintain a prioritized roadmap, constructively challenging requests, and proposing scalable alternatives.
  • Drive the pre-research phase independently: utilize analytical skills to identify trends, validate assumptions, and conduct data analysis without reliance on developers.
  • Accelerate project lifecycles by leveraging AI tools (e.g., for requirements, user stories, and functional design) to expedite deployment.
  • Take end-to-end ownership of functional deliverables, including process definition, requirements gathering, and fit/gap analysis, while assessing systemic impacts on the Quote-to-Cash ecosystem.
  • Oversee operational objectives, including work plans, delegation, resource allocation, and project estimation.
  • Drive Agile delivery by leading sprint planning, standups, retrospectives, and cross-functional design sessions.
  • Provide hands-on technical guidance, including reviewing code, troubleshooting, and supporting test efforts.
  • Maintain a proactive understanding of current Salesforce releases and industry best practices.


Technical Leadership:
  • Experience with Salesforce Revenue Cloud Advanced, CPQ, Sales Cloud
  • Be recognized as a technical & functional specialist in Salesforce Lead-to-Cash space
  • Understanding of how to build reusable, lightweight code in Apex, LWC and facilitating the custom versus config conversation to lead the best in class architecture while meeting business objectives
  • Provide technical leadership during design, development and post production with complex technical designs and think industry leading practices
  • Develop, test, and document working custom development, integrations, and data migrations for Salesforce features, and projects
  • Communicate and work effectively with cross functional teams including business teams, product teams, global IT Apps teams, consultants & vendors
  • Build Prototypes & Present POVs on complex solution options and benefits to key program stakeholders


Resource and Budget Management:
  • Monitor team budget and expenditures, identifying cost-saving opportunities.
  • Ensure optimal allocation and utilization of resources.
  • Collaborate with delivery managers to improve velocity by tracking relevant metrics
  • Manage Agile delivery with US and Offshore teams
  • Manage FTE and Consulting Development and QA resources


What You'll Need:
  • 8+ years of Salesforce development or equivalent experience on a cross-functional development team specifically around - Demand-to-Cash, Lead-to-Cash or Quote-to-Cash
  • Knowledge of CPQ,Revenue Cloud Advanced, Sales Cloud
  • Knowledge of application development using configuration and code - specifically Apex, LWC, visual force and other salesforce related technologies
  • 2+ years of managing Salesforce developers and contractors using agile methodology
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or equivalent practical experience
  • Security minded and strong working knowledge of vulnerabilities around SOQL, Apex, and other areas of the platform that can be leveraged by bad actors
  • Experience working in a business consulting role with excellent presentation and documentation skills
  • Proven experience in technical delivery and resource management
  • Fanatical focus on the seller and partner experience
  • Proven experience utilizing AI technologies to enhance decision-making, streamline workflows and processes, improve efficiency and drive business outcomes.
